HC Deb 07 November 1988 vol 140 c108W
Mr. Sheerman

To ask the Secretary of State for Transport what steps he is taking to increase the rate of implementation of those low cost highway engineering schemes which have been identified for implementation on trunk roads which form part of the backlog of 3,900 low cost schemes identified by the National Audit Office in June.

Mr. Peter Bottomley

The 3,900 backlog mentioned by the National Audit Office was on local not trunk roads. As far as trunk roads are concerned, in rephasing new construction schemes this year, we have given priority to low-cost accident prevention schemes. The basis for the National Audit Office figure is not clear from its report. We are seeking more details of the scale and nature of the problem.
